Why Choose an Electric Vehicle in 2025?

The electric vehicle landscape in 2025 has matured significantly, offering improvements in range, charging infrastructure, battery life, and overall performance. Government subsidies, reduced maintenance costs, and rising fuel prices are compelling more Indian and global consumers to make the switch.

Key benefits of owning an EV in 2025:

  •  Zero tailpipe emissions
  •  Lower running and maintenance costs
  •  Government incentives and tax benefits
  •  Access to growing EV charging infrastructure
  •  Future-proof technology with OTA (over-the-air) updates

Budget EVs (Under ₹10 Lakh)

Ideal for daily commuters and small families, these EVs offer practical range, affordability, and ease of ownership.

Tata Tiago EV

• Price: ₹6.99 – ₹8.99 lakh (ex-showroom)
• Range: 250–315 km (MIDC)
• Top Features: Touchscreen infotainment, regen modes, fast charging
• Best for: City driving and short commutes


MG Comet EV

• Price: ₹7.98 lakh onwards
• Range: 230 km (ARAI)
• Top Features: Ultra-compact design, 10.25-inch dual screens
• Best for: Urban mobility and tight parking spots

Mid-Range EVs (₹11 – ₹20 Lakh)

For families and longer daily commutes, these EVs offer greater comfort, space, and range.

Tata Nexon EV (Long Range)

• Price: ₹14.49 – ₹19.49 lakh
• Range: Up to 465 km (ARAI)
• Top Features: New-gen design, 12.3-inch touchscreen, ADAS features
• Best for: Family use and highway drives

Mahindra XUV400 EV

• Price: ₹15.49 – ₹18.99 lakh
• Range: 375–465 km
• Top Features: Sporty performance, large boot space, fast charging
• Best for: SUV lovers seeking EV power

Luxury & Performance EVs (Above ₹70 Lakh)

Aimed at enthusiasts and executives, these EVs offer exhilarating speed, advanced automation, and unmatched luxury.

BMW iX

• Price: ₹1.21 crore
• Range: 425–450 km
• Top Features: Dual motor AWD, intelligent assistant, glass cabin
• Best for: Luxury seekers with a tech mindset

Mercedes-Benz EQS 580

• Price: ₹1.62 crore
• Range: 857 km (ARAI)
• Top Features: Hyperscreen, rear-wheel steering, Level 2 autonomy
• Best for: Premium chauffeur-driven experience

Conclusion: Which EV Should You Buy in 2025?

Your ideal EV in 2025 depends on how you intend to use it:

• Daily Commuting? Tata Tiago EV or MG Comet
• Family Utility? Nexon EV or Mahindra XUV400
• Highway Driving? Hyundai IONIQ 5 or Kia EV6
• Luxury Experience? EQS 580 or BMW iX

With improving infrastructure, falling battery costs, and increasing options, there has never been a better time to consider an electric vehicle.
Make sure to test-drive multiple options and evaluate long-term ownership costs to choose the EV that best fits your lifestyle.
